Honda CB350 H'ness vs Moto Morini SEIEMMEZZO 6 ½

Last Updated: September 11, 2026

Honda CB350 H'ness price starts at Rs. 1.94 Lakh, which is Rs. 2.45 Lakh cheaper than the base variant of Moto Morini SEIEMMEZZO 6 ½, priced at Rs. 4.39 Lakh. In terms of mileage, the CB350 H'ness offers a claimed 45.8 kmpl, while the SEIEMMEZZO 6 ½ delivers 22 kmpl. On the performance front, the CB350 H'ness uses a 348.36cc engine producing 21.07 PS @ 5500 rpm and the SEIEMMEZZO 6 ½ a 649cc engine producing 55.7 PS @ 8250 rpm. If you're deciding between the CB350 H'ness and SEIEMMEZZO 6 ½, the CB350 H'ness is the better pick for affordability and mileage, while the SEIEMMEZZO 6 ½ stands out for performance.

Q. Performance wise and riding experience wise which is better meteor 350 or honda hness?
  • The Honda H'ness CB350 and Royal Enfield Meteor 350 are 350cc motorcycles with distinct characteristics. The H'ness CB350 (348.36cc) delivers 21.07 PS and 30 Nm, featuring all-LED lighting and Bluetooth-enabled navigation. The Meteor 350 (349cc) produces 20.4 PS and 27 Nm, equipped with a semi-digital instrument cluster and a halogen headlamp. Both models include dual-channel ABS and a 15L fuel tank.
